The law firm of Sauder Schelkopf LLC is investigating a class action lawsuit on behalf of Toyota Venza, Camry and RAV4 vehicles (model years 2019-2021) that are prone to windshield cracking.  It has been alleged that consumers with these Toyota vehicles are experiencing windshield cracking from normal vehicle use that, in some instances, results in complete windshield breakage.  Many vehicle owners even report that nothing hit their windshields to cause the cracking or breakage.  It has also been alleged that consumers who present their vehicles to Toyota for repair are informed that the windshields are not covered under warranty and are denied warranty coverage for the necessary repairs or, in situations where windshield replacement is required, Toyota does not have the parts needed to complete the replacement.  As a result, current and former owners and lessees may be forced to pay for replacement windshields and repairs out-of-pocket or be stuck with a non-useable vehicle for long periods of time while awaiting the parts required for the repair to be completed.
